A proclamation [electronic resource] : Whereas the General Assembly of this state, at their sessions at Hartford in May last, did enact, that there be forthwith raised within this state, by voluntary inlistment, eighteen hundred and thirty-six able-bodied effective men ... to be held in readiness to ... join and act in conjunction with the Continental Army ... I have therefore thought fit ... to offer ... as an encouragement to each ... that he shall have his poll exempted ... Given under my hand, at Lebanon .. the 20th day of June, A.D. 1782.
